Art Gallery of Ontario

The "Art Gallery of Ontario" got a new glass facade by Frank O. Gehry, but inside it is still one of the best art museums in Canada. From African Art to Contemporary Art everything is represented in the great collection of the Art Gallery.

Royal Ontario Museum

The Natural History and Ethnology Museum recieved an extension by Daniel Libeskind in 2007. Now the "Royal Ontario Museum" has a huge crystal as frontage. Interesting exhibitions enrich the wide range of the Museum.

Bata Shoe Museum

The "Bata Shoe Museum" got it's collection from the famous Czech shoe company of "Bata". The museum was created in 1995 by the Japanese architect Moriyama. In a shoebox like building, shoes from all continents and epochs are displayed.

Sharp Centre for Design

The "Sharp Centre for Design" is part of the "Ontario College of Art and Design". The elevated building was designed  by English architect Will Alsop in 2004. The futuristic "Sharp Centre" has won numerous architectural awards. However, it is not an exhibition hall for art or design, the building itself is a piece of art.
